Wood Breaks Through In Style

ASCS Sooner Region, Lawton Speedway

LAWTON, Okla. — Joe Wood, Jr. cashed in on his first career American Bank of Oklahoma ASCS Sooner Region victory by wiring the field in Saturday night’s 25-lap event at Lawton Speedway.
Gunning into the lead at the outset, the Oklahoma City racer survived traffic over the final rounds to beat Zach Chappell and Kevin Ramey to the checkered flag.
“Traffic was a challenge with everyone running different lines around the track,” the 23-year old explained from victory lane.  “I was just trying to stay focused.”
Brian McClelland and Andy Shouse rounded out the top five.
The finish:
Joe Wood, Jr., Zach Chappell, Kevin Ramey, Brian McClelland, Andy Shouse, Justin Melton, Gary Taylor, Kerry McAlister, Eric Baldaccini, Sean McClelland, Matt Covington, Danny Jennings, Landon Brown, Michael Brown, Jason Botsford, Jeff Dodd, Sheldon Barksdale, Earnest Jennings, Kyle Merriman, Robert Sellers, Rick Barksdale, Kolt Walker.
